Most Searched Undergraduate Schools In Florida Colleges Student Population Comparison

For the academic year 2022-2023, the total student population of Most Searched Undergraduate Schools In Florida Colleges is 26,728.
The proportion of undergraduate students is 99.16% (26,503 students) and graduate students's proportion is 0.84% (225 graduate students).
Hillsborough Community College has the most students of 19,504 among Most Searched Undergraduate Schools In Florida Colleges. By gender, the male-female ratio at Most Searched Undergraduate Schools In Florida Colleges is 41.89% (11,197 male students) to 58.11% (15,531 female students).
